This is the first of a trio of paintings done a different style than I normally do and is also different than the style of the rest of the series. I think it's important sometimes to branch out and experiment in order to help yourself grow. I'm pleased with the depth of layers and think that that can be pushed even more. The following two posts are the other paintings in the trio. This piece is currently on exhibit at the Central Utah Arts Center for their Fourth Annual Utah Juried Show until April the 23rd.

Genesis 1:10 "And God called the dry land Earth; and the gathering together of the waters called he Seas: and God saw that it was good."
